This is my sample for CC884. I am your hostess this week and I chose pumpkin pie, so saffron and highland heather for my color trio. Dessert Option this week is any designer paper.
My card took a lot of twists and turns this week. I picked this designer paper for the colors, and I had a layout in my mind. Then it changed completely, and I ended up with a fun fold center step layout.
The background designer paper reminds me of the tulip fields in the Netherlands. Never been there just have seen photos. The paper is from the Stampin' Up "flowering fields" collection.
So, with the Netherlands as my inspiration, I decided to add a windmill that I cut in the challenge colors from a CottageCutz die. The Easter phrase is another CottageCutz die. I cut in highland heather cardstock then sponged with the same ink to get a deeper shade.
I used an older stamp set from SNSS for the bottom panel of the card, and I added a few tulips to finish it off.
